2G-specific 95 eclipse wont start :/ ..... please help

okay. so ive got a 95 eclipse gsT.
had major overheating issues apparntly because coolant wasnt pressurized correctly.
replaced water pump, redid timing, new seals, now theres ZERO leaks.

Tried to start the car.. forgot to plug the CPS in, the car started, ran for a seconds, and died. realized it wasnt plugged in. plugged it in. not it will not start anymore...
sounds like it wants to, but just not happening.
Possible bad CPS sensor?? The car has spark, has fuel.
The car basically overheated(not in the red but close)
and blew the water pump and with all that replaced it hasnt ran since....(few days ago)

Any suggestions?!
I have no idea where to even look and begin anymore.
Please help......

the 2G runs and drives fine now. it had some vacuum lines not pluged in and needed a new head, headgasket, waterpump, mas and map sensor, boost controler (pushin 20 or more psi) running a bastard 20g turbo, and it blew the fmic piping. when driving to redmond to the last nissan/dsm/evo meet and blew the FMIC piping on the side of i-405. but now it works fine but still needs a boost controler or its still going to blow the IC piping.
